Maple Nutty Banana Bread (No Refined-Sugar)

Makes 9×5-inch loaf

Wet ingredients:

  • 3 (very) ripe bananas
  • 2 eggs
  • 1/4 cup avocado oil
  • 2 tbsp melted unsalted butter
  • 1/4 cup pure maple syrup
  • 1/4 cup half n half (or whole milk)
  • 2 tsp vanilla extract

Dry ingredients:

  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 tbsp ground flaxseeds
  • 1 tsp baking soda
  • 1/2 tsp mineral salt
  • 1/2 tsp cinnamon
  • 1/2 cup finely chopped walnuts
  • 1/4 cup finely chopped pecans

Topping:

  • extra finely walnuts & pecans

Instructions:

  1. Preheat the oven to 325°F (163°C). Lightly grease or line a 9×5-inch loaf pan with parchment paper.
  2. In a large bowl, whisk together all wet ingredients until smooth and well combined.
  3. Continue to add dry ingredients. Gently fold the ingredients together just until no dry flour remains. Be careful not to overmix.
  4. Fold in the finely chopped walnuts and pecans until evenly distributed.
  5. Pour the batter into the prepared loaf pan and smooth the top.
  6. Sprinkle with additional chopped walnuts and pecans.
  7. Bake for 60–70 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ean or with just a few moist crumbs.
  8. Allow the banana bread to cool completely in the pan before slicing and serving

Storage Tips

  • Room Temperature: Once completely cooled, store the banana bread in an airtight glass container or wrap it in unbleached parchment paper and place it in a bread box or reusable container. It will stay fresh for up to 3 days.
  • Refrigerator: Store in an airtight glass container for up to 1 week. Let it come to room temperature or warm a slice slightly before serving for the best texture.
  • Freezer: Slice the loaf and separate each piece with unbleached parchment paper. Store the slices in a reusable silicone freezer bag or a freezer-safe glass container for up to 3 months. Thaw at room temperature or warm gently before enjoying.
